Eve Holding Inc is a provider of Urban Air Mobility solutions. The company's operating segments are; eVTOL that includes; the design and production of electric vertical take-off and landing vehicles (eVTOLs) including fixed wing and helicopter operators, as well as lessors that purchase and manage aircraft on behalf of operators; Service and Operations Solutions segment which includes a portfolio of maintenance and support services focused on its and third-party eVTOLs; and the UATM segment, a new Urban Air Traffic Management system designed to allow eVTOLs to operate safely and efficiently in dense urban airspace alongside conventional aircraft and drones.
Tandem Diabetes designs, manufactures, and markets durable insulin pumps for individuals with diabetes. The firm first entered this market in 2012 and has since introduced multiple generations of pumps leading to its current t:slim X2 device. The firm recently launched its smaller Mobi pump and continues to work on Tobi (a tubeless version of Mobi), and the Sigi tubeless patch pump. Nearly three-quarters of total revenue is derived from the US, with the remainder primarily from other developed nations. The pumps themselves generate just over half of total sales, and another one-third is from disposable infusion sets that need to be changed over every 2 to 3 days.
